Finance Review Summary — Q2, Tollbridge Fabrics

Marketing spend reduced 22% against plan. Cuts fall mainly on the Larkspool campaign and trade events in Merrowton. Digital channels retained at 90% of prior budget. Forecast impact: modest lead decline in Q3, recoverable by Q4. Agency contracts with Pinefold Creative renegotiated; retainer halved. Headcount unaffected this cycle. Variance detail is in the ledger appendix. For the incoming director, a confidential note on forward plans is appended immediately below.

management briefing: Project Ulavan slips by two quarters because of the staffing delay.

Routefall assigns drivers via a weighted heuristic: proximity, shift load, and acceptance rate. Plugin authors cannot override scoring directly; submit hints through the `bias` field instead. All heuristic endpoints require a signed request against the Dispatchcore internal service. Tokens rotate quarterly. Do not cache scores longer than 60 seconds — assignments invalidate on shift changes. Sandbox traffic routes through the Kelvrath staging cluster automatically. Requests without a valid key return 401 with no retry hint. Use the key below.

app token of kagap-fahag = zpat2_0m

# Limits and Quotas: Inkmill Rendering Pipeline

Inkmill renders user markdown server-side. To keep render workers healthy, we enforce hard caps on input size, nesting depth, and per-document render time; anything over the limit returns a truncated preview instead of blocking the queue. Embedded images and math blocks count against separate quotas since they dominate CPU. Reviewers should reject changes that bypass these checks in any code path. The enforced limits are defined by the constants below.

limits module of yadug-tawip:
QUOTAS = {
    "julael": 705,
    "kasael": 903,
    "druwyn": 489,
}